All of a sudden all objects are being rearranged
...while simply extending a line.
I pasted a few objects from another document into a new document. One of these objects was a line, which I was dragging longer. Once I released the mouse button, all objects rearranged (horizontal alignment > see attached file) automatically. I can't undo this action (meaning I have to redo this page). FYI: no diagram style has been selected, so this shouldn't be the problem (I guess) Since this isn't the first time this happened and I can't find it elsewhere in the forum: [B]Can anybody help me with this problem?[/B] I'm using Omnigraffle Pro 5.2.1 on OS X 10.5.3 [IMG]http://digital.tmpw.nl/omnigraffle_error.png[/IMG] |
The document template you used has auto layout turned on. Use the diagram layout inspector to turn it off.
